Description
Beckett's Whisper (originally for Irish flute, pennywhistle, violin, cello, Celtic harp, accordian, double bass and piano)
Composed by Ron Korb
Published by Nourse Wind Publications
Includes score and parts
This work was inspired by the life of Samuel Beckett (1906 – 1989), an Irish-born playwright, who spent much of his life in France. The composer percieves a sense of longing for the homeland he left and ponders on the life impressions it has made on him, and those he has made on it.
Transcribed for the Canadian Flute Association for flute choir: (optional Piccolo), 4 C Flutes (flute 4 requires low B foot), Alto flute, Bass flute, (optional Contrabass flute) Performance notes by the composer are included in the set.
